The Role

Junior Estimator working under the guidance of Senior Estimators with responsibilities for :-

  • Support Senior Estimators in the review and assessment of tender documentation, including drawings, specifications, reports and project scope requirements. 
  • Prepare consultant, subcontractor and material enquiry packages, and assist with cost analysis, comparisons and pricing activities using estimating software. 
  • Manage and maintain tender documentation throughout the tender process, ensuring accuracy, organisation and compliance with company procedures. 
  • Assist in the preparation and submission of tender returns, project handover documentation and estimating reports. 
  • Contribute to the pricing and review of preliminaries and maintain estimating data to support tender applications and project delivery.
